small changes
This commit is contained in:
@ -18,22 +18,23 @@ in {
|
||||
};
|
||||
};
|
||||
|
||||
config = lib.mkIf cfg.podman.enable {
|
||||
virtualisation.podman = {
|
||||
enable = true;
|
||||
dockerCompat = cfg.podman.dockerCompat;
|
||||
enableOnBoot = true;
|
||||
defaultNetwork.settings.dns_enabled = true;
|
||||
};
|
||||
|
||||
environment.systemPackages =
|
||||
[
|
||||
pkgs.podman-compose
|
||||
pkgs.buildah
|
||||
pkgs.skopeo
|
||||
pkgs.dive
|
||||
pkgs.container-diff
|
||||
]
|
||||
++ cfg.podman.extraPackages;
|
||||
};
|
||||
config = lib.mkIf cfg.enable (lib.attrsets.optionalAttrs (config.nixpkgs.hostPlatform.isLinux) {
|
||||
virtualisation.podman = {
|
||||
enable = true;
|
||||
dockerCompat = cfg.dockerCompat;
|
||||
enableOnBoot = true;
|
||||
defaultNetwork.settings.dns_enabled = true;
|
||||
};
|
||||
}
|
||||
// {
|
||||
environment.systemPackages =
|
||||
[
|
||||
pkgs.podman-compose
|
||||
pkgs.buildah
|
||||
pkgs.skopeo
|
||||
pkgs.dive
|
||||
pkgs.container-diff
|
||||
]
|
||||
++ cfg.extraPackages;
|
||||
});
|
||||
}
|
||||
|
Reference in New Issue
Block a user